In the middle of a city, there was a museum that was decorated with beautiful marble tiles (大理石砖) and a huge marble statue (大理石像). Many people from all over the world visited the museum every day and admired the statue. One night, the marble tiles started talking to the marble statue.

Tiles: Hey statue. Don’t you think it’s unfair that everybody comes here to admire you while stepping on us?

Statue: My dear brothers. Don’t you remember that we are actually from the same place?

Tiles: Yes, we do. That is why we feel it is even more unfair. All of us were born from the same place, and yet the world treats us so differently now. This is so unfair!

Statue: Yes, you are right, my brothers. But do you still remember the day when the artist tried to work on you, but you refused him?

Tiles: Yes, we didn’t like him. We turned him away because we didn’t want to get hurt.

Statue: Well, since you refused his tools, he couldn’t work on you. When he decided to give up on you, he started working on me. I knew at once that I would be something different and special after his hard work. I bore (忍受) all the pain and allowed him to fashion (雕琢) me as he wanted!

Tiles: But it hurt quite a lot.

Statue: My brothers, there is a price for everything in life. Since you decided to give up halfway, you can’t complain about the world’s unfairness to you.?

The marble tiles became quiet and deep in thought. The harder the knocks you go through in life, the more you learn and can put to use in the future!
